Research Opportunities

Research is an integral part of civil engineering education, and the UK universities listed below offer exceptional research opportunities:

  • University of Cambridge: The Department of Engineering at Cambridge is renowned for its cutting-edge research in civil engineering, with a focus on sustainable infrastructure, geotechnical engineering, and computational mechanics.
  • University of Oxford: The Department of Engineering Science at Oxford offers a range of research projects in civil engineering, including smart materials, bridge design, and environmental engineering.
  • University of Bath: The Department of Architecture and Civil Engineering at Bath is known for its research in sustainable construction, geotechnical engineering, and transportation engineering.
  • University of Sheffield: The Department of Civil and Structural Engineering at Sheffield offers a variety of research projects in areas such as bridge engineering, geotechnical engineering, and water resources management.

Industry Connections

Strong industry connections are essential for civil engineering students to gain practical experience and build a network of professionals. The following universities have a strong track record in fostering industry relationships:

  • University of Sheffield: Sheffield has a long-standing partnership with industry leaders, providing students with opportunities to work on real-world projects and internships.
  • University of Bath: Bath has strong connections with the construction industry, offering students the chance to work on live projects and collaborate with industry experts.
  • Imperial College London: Imperial College London has a strong focus on industry collaboration, with numerous partnerships with leading engineering firms and government agencies.
